Beyond its agony-relieving consequences, conolidine has demonstrated a positive security margin in preclinical toxicology assessments. In contrast to opioids, which often result in respiratory despair at increased doses, conolidine hasn't produced signs of significant respiratory suppression. Most lately, it's been discovered that conolidine and the above derivatives act within the atypical chemokine receptor three (ACKR3. Expressed in very similar spots as classical opioid receptors, it binds to your wide array of endogenous opioids. Unlike most opioid receptors, this receptor functions like a scavenger and doesn't activate a 2nd messenger procedure (fifty nine). As discussed by Meyrath et al., this also indicated a feasible hyperlink in between these receptors and also the endogenous opiate procedure (59). This analyze in the long run decided that the ACKR3 receptor did not make any G protein sign reaction by measuring and discovering no mini G protein interactions, compared with classical opiate receptors, which recruit these proteins for signaling.
